When Jonas Vingegaard was celebrated in Glyngøre, 14-year-old Liv was ready with a very special gift: a portrait of the cycling star made of 26,390 beads — three weeks of work.
Many wanted to celebrate Jonas Vingegaard when PostNord Danmark Rundt rolled out from Glyngøre this week, and the cycling star was honored on stage for his historic Giro d'Italia victory. But one gift stood out.
14-year-old Liv Bendix Hansen had traveled all the way from Haderslev to Glyngøre with her mother and little brother — and under her arm, she had a portrait of Jonas Vingegaard made of 26,390 beads.
According to TV MIDTVEST, which covered the celebration, Liv spent three weeks making the bead plate. And she didn't take any chances on the day: already an hour and a half before Vingegaard showed up, she was ready by the stage.
— I think Jonas is really inspiring. He is a great idol, Liv told TV MIDTVEST.
Vingegaard was presented with the portrait before he left the stage, and after the celebration, Liv got to meet her great idol and get an autograph. The meeting made such a big impression that she couldn't hold back her tears.
To put the number into perspective: a classic bead plate contains 841 beads (29×29). Liv's portrait corresponds to more than 31 full plates combined into one large motif. It's the kind of project where you need to keep track of color codes, sort beads into bowls, and iron plate by plate — and where three weeks of work suddenly sounds quite fast.
Bead portraits from photos are some of the most challenging projects you can tackle with fuse beads. Skin tones require many shades, and the motif must strike a balance between detail and recognizability. Liv's portrait shows how beautiful it can turn out when you dare to go all in.
